A new movie will be released by the South Korean boy band BTS and it will be released in cinemas globally this year on August 7.  The project titled Bring the Soul: The Movie follows Burn the Stage: The Movie which was released last year and most recently Love Yourself in Seoul, which took fans behind the scenes of what it’s like to be part of BTS.

The movie Bring the Soul follows the group in the days following their Love Yourself tour through Europe, after the boy-band held 24 concerts in 12 cities which includes two dates at the Wembley Stadium in London.

“From Seoul to Paris, the tour was full of energy and passion,” the synopsis reads. “On the day following the final Paris concert, on a rooftop table in the city, the boys begin a small after-party, sharing their own stories as never heard before.”

“Trafalgar Releasing is thrilled to collaborate with Big Hit Entertainment again for Bring the Soul: The Movie, giving fans around the world an intimate opportunity to see the band following their landmark Love Yourself tour” said Marc Allenby, the CEO of Trafalgar Releasing.

“The Army’s are truly a community, and we are excited to bring them together for an all-new BTS experience in cinemas worldwide.” He continued.
